Saki Konishi is a character in Persona 4. She is the sister of Naoki Konishi and the second victim of the bizarre murders surrounding Inaba.

Appearances[]

Design[]

Saki has thick, long, wavy light-brown hair and brown eyes. At school she wears a standard school uniform with black stockings and brown shoes, yet with white knee-length socks in the anime. When she works at Junes, she wears a long-sleeved white shirt, faded navy jeans, navy sneakers, and an employee apron.

In the first Golden anime opening, she is briefly seen wearing a pink blazer and dark gray shirt with gray blue jeans and black shoes.

Since Saki dies quite early into the game, most of her personality and daily behavior is unknown, and she was unable to provide any first-hand accounts herself. The only information that the protagonist gets about her is from Yosuke Hanamura and Naoki Konishi, the former being her co-worker and the latter being her brother. Yosuke notes that she was nosy around him yet worked hard at Junes, despite not appearing to have. Naoki sees her as a playful yet surprisingly mature individual, and after coming to terms with his feelings, realizes that he misses her dearly.

At first, she seemed like a kind person who was nice and supportive to Yosuke. However, it is revealed that she was actually quite stressed about her life, with a lot of pent-up angst and a desire to get away from it all. It is also revealed that the pressure led her to believe her family, friends, and neighbors had resented her all along because she worked at Junes, the giant store that was slowly driving her family's liquor shop out of business. If the protagonist speaks to Yasogami High students the day after her death, one female student will reveal there have been bad rumors circulating throughout school about her, and she herself cannot feel sorry about Saki's death.

A senior to the protagonist and Yosuke Hanamura, she works as a part-time worker at Junes. She is the eldest daughter of a family who owns the local liquor store Konishi Liquors, who failed to compete with the nearby Junes Department Store and lost sales nearly to the point of getting shut down like many other stores. Her brother Naoki is the protagonist's underclassman.

She was first seen talking with her brother Naoki about some leftovers of his that she ate on the first day the protagonist came to Inaba.

The protagonist meets her as she takes a break from her part-time job at Junes. She informs the protagonist that Yosuke's father is the manager of Junes and that she is Yosuke's co-worker. She sees Yosuke as a nosy little brother and calls him "Hana-chan" as a way of playfully teasing him. Yosuke harbors romantic feelings for Saki, but fails to confess to her and this love is unrequited as a result. Saki is later revealed to be the person who first found Mayumi Yamano's body, making her nervous and scared.

Later, when the protagonist, Chie Satonaka, and Yosuke watch the Midnight Channel, the trio observes a blurred image of a female student resembling Saki Konishi, who appears to be writhing in pain. Two days later, the Yasogami High students are tragically informed that Saki was found murdered. Her corpse was hung upside-down on a telephone pole. Coroners estimated her time of death was at around 1 in the morning on April 15. Devastated by her death, Yosuke requests the protagonist take him into the Midnight Channel, as the protagonist is the only one capable of entering the TV.

Saki's inner thoughts are later revealed when the protagonist and Yosuke investigate the Midnight Channel's Twisted Shopping District. In reality, Saki was under immense pressure due to her family's liquor store falling over to the opening of Junes' Inaba branch. Furthermore, her decision to take a job as a part-timer at Junes greatly irritated her family, and as such, her father would often scold her for her decisions. This would be proven by the manifestation of the voices in the Shopping District. After becoming a witness to the murder case, her dilemma grew worse as her classmates and friends talked behind her back. It is also unknown if she encountered her Shadow Self, although Persona 4 The Animation implies it with two figures seen on the Midnight Channel. After dealing with Shadow Yosuke, Yosuke accepts his inner feelings.

Regardless, the protagonist and Yosuke would hear Saki's voice who would claim she despised Yosuke for his enthusiasm towards her, and only befriended him because he is the son of the manager of Junes.[1] She also hates Junes especially because it ruined her relationship with her family, the town and their business as a whole.

There would be many rumors circulating Saki, but several people would vouch for her and insist she's being misunderstood, Yosuke himself being one of the most prominent instances: Yosuke considers her a good person at heart, and gets angry when people disparage her.[2] Despite her distaste towards Yosuke, which Yosuke himself is forced to acknowledge, Saki is arguably the main motivation Yosuke has for venturing into the Midnight Channel and solving its mysteries.

If the protagonist levels up the Magician Social Link to rank six, it is revealed that Saki was rumored to be having a relationship with a college student, and planned to leave Inaba with him until she backed out with the decision to save up for leaving Inaba on her own, presumably part of the reason she decided to work at Junes. Naoki, however, suggests in rank seven of the Hanged Man Social Link that Saki believed her work for Junes would one day be of some benefit to her family's business.

In the final stages of their investigation, the group is able to hear Taro Namatame's story and Saki's involvement in it: they would also debunk a certain misconception that Namatame approached Saki to hit on her. After he observed Yamano die following her appearance on the Midnight Channel, he then saw Saki on the channel. Fearing that a similar fate awaited Saki, Namatame attempted to warn her to be careful, but this failed to keep her from dying, thus instigating his efforts to save people by forcibly throwing them into the TV under the impression that what he was doing was not dangerous.

Shortly afterwards, the group is able to hear the account of the true culprit, Tohru Adachi, about what really happened to Saki. He questioned Saki as a witness much more than was normal for a person with such a strong alibi. The night they saw her on the Midnight Channel, Saki was questioned by Adachi at the police station. Adachi aggressively tried to flirt with her and she slapped him, causing him to react violently by picking her up and throwing her into the TV, causing Shadows to kill her the next day, which Adachi justifies by calling her a "gold digger" trying to get Namatame's attention. Unlike the previous case with Yamano, Adachi deliberately threw Saki into the TV knowing full well not only that he could but that she would be in mortal danger.

Persona 4 The Animation[]

In the animated adaptation of Persona 4, when she was cast into the Midnight Channel, she did not panic nor get afraid when her "other self" appeared. The only reactions she experienced were confusion and disorientation. Then in Namatame's flashback, she is last seen with her Shadow about to transform into the black smoke and finally killing her through suffocation.

Persona 4 The Magician[]

At the Yasogami Culture Festival of 2010, Saki overhears gossip about Yosuke as the local Junes manager's son while seeing him walk by to the school rooftop, so she follows him to start a short conversation and advise him not to listen to people talking behind his back. About two weeks later, she begins her part-time job at Junes and tells this to a surprised Yosuke while working.

When Yosuke sees Saki on the job at Junes on Valentine's Day, he hears customers gossiping about her which prompts him to grab her without warning and pull her away. After listening to him complain about these people talking negatively without shame, Saki gives him chocolate for what she reasoned as out of sympathy before going back to work.

Yosuke later gives Saki a picture of them and other workers at Junes. Following this are the events of the game where Saki introduces herself at Junes and gets killed by her Shadow. Her remaining thoughts of despising Yosuke remain in the Midnight Channel's version of her family's liquor store.

Persona 4 The Golden Animation[]

In the opening intro, Saki is seen going to her part-time job at Junes. The scene where Adachi gets slapped by her and throws her into the TV is recapped in Episode 6.

Persona 4: Kiri no Amnesia[]

Yosuke meets Amnesia, a character that takes on the form of Saki's Shadow. Her Shadow was created out of a desire to forget and escape the hardships of her reality.

Etymology[]

  • The name Saki means "already, now, fast, early" (早) (sa) and "chronicle" (紀) (ki).
  • Saki's surname Konishi means "small" (小) (ko) and "west" (西) (nishi)
